
Gabi Lorenzo, a second-year master’s student in Sports Product Design, is working on a project that leverages technology affiliated with the UO Phil and Penny Knight Campus for Accelerating Scientific Impact. Alongside her professor and Director of UO’s Sports Product Design Program, Susan Sokolowski, the pair are conducting research around a wearable sensor into a shoe with potential to prevent injury and improve performance.
